Maharana Pratap Memorial Middle School, Bhirauti, Gurugram, Haryana was established in 1940 by Shri Ram Swarup Garg. The school is situated in the Bhirauti area of Gurugram. It is a co-educational school that imparts education from class 1 to 8.The school is named after Maharana Pratap, a legendary Rajput warrior and folk hero from the 16th century. He was known for his bravery and resistance to the Mughal Empire.
